Imec and Renesas Electronics report record ADC for next-generation high-bandwidth wireless receivers
At this week’s International Solid-State Circuit Conference (ISSCC2012), imec and Renesas Electronics Corporation report an innovative SAR (successive-approximation register) ADC (analog to digital converter) with a spectacular improvement in power efficiency and speed, targeting wireless receivers for next-generation high-bandwidth standards such as LTE-advanced and the emerging generation of Wi-Fi (IEEE802.11ac).

New record low-power multi-standard transceiver for sensor networks
Imec and Holst Centre announce a 2.3/2.4GHz transmitter for wireless sensor applications compliant with 4 wireless standards (IEEE802.15.6/4/4g and Bluetooth Low Energy). The transmitter has been fabricated in a 90nm CMOS process, and consumes only 5.4mW from a 1.2V supply (2.7nJ/bit) at 0dBm output. This is 3 to 5 times more power-efficient than the current state-of-the-art Bluetooth-LE solutions.

Belden presents the new OpenBAT series from its Hirschmann product range
Belden’s new OpenBAT range from Hirschmann is the first modular system to enable industry-standard WLAN access points and clients to be configured via the internet. This range, comprising the BAT-R (IP20) and BAT-F (IP67) series, supports the IEEE 802.11n transmission standard, which facilitates data speeds of up to 450Mbps in both the 5GHz and the 2.4GHz bands.
